Factors to Consider While Choosing a Fish Tank Stand

Material:

Firstly, the material of the stand should be sturdy and long-lasting. Fish tanks are heavy, and therefore the stand needs to be able to withstand the weight of the tank along with its contents. Steel stands are highly durable and can hold more weight than wooden stands. Wooden stands, however, provide a more aesthetic look and can blend in better with your home interiors. Make sure the stand is made from quality materials that do not degrade or rot when exposed to water over time.

Size:

The size of the stand should be appropriately matched with the size of the fish tank. A 10-gallon fish tank requires a stand that is big enough to support the entire surface area of the tank. A stand that is too small can cause instability, leading to the tank tipping over, which could be catastrophic for your fish. Ensure that the stand is the same dimensions as the base of the tank to prevent any accidents.

Weight Capacity:

Before selecting a stand, it is essential to understand the weight capacity it can hold. A 10-gallon fish tank filled with water can weigh up to 100 pounds. Therefore, it is crucial to choose a stand that can hold the weight of the tank, along with other accessories such as filters and lights. Be sure to check the weight limit before purchasing the stand to ensure the safety of your fish.

Design:

Lastly, the design of the stand is also an important factor. The stand should provide easy access to the tank for maintenance and cleaning. Choose a stand that has shelves or cabinets to store all your fish-related equipment. Additionally, pick a stand that matches your home decor, so it looks like an intentional addition to your room.

Expert Tips on Maintaining Your Fish Tank Stand

Tip #1: Regular Inspection

One of the most crucial aspects of maintaining your fish tank stand is regular inspection. You should conduct a thorough check of your stand at least once a month. Check for any signs of cracks or damage in the legs, braces, or shelves. Inspect the screws, bolts, and nuts for any wear and tear and tighten them if necessary. If you notice any significant damage, it is best to replace the stand immediately.

Tip #2: Keep it Clean

Regular cleaning is another essential aspect of maintaining your fish tank stand. Wipe down the surface of the stand with a damp cloth to remove any dust or dirt. Avoid using harsh chemical cleaners as they can damage the finish of the stand. Instead, use a mild soap solution or vinegar solution to clean the stand. Remember to dry the stand thoroughly after cleaning to prevent water damage.

Tip #3: Proper Placement

The placement of your fish tank stand is also crucial in maintaining its stability. Always place the stand on a level surface to prevent wobbling or tipping. Make sure the floor is strong enough to support the weight of the stand and the aquarium. Avoid placing the stand near windows or doors where it may be exposed to direct sunlight or drafts.

Tip #4: Consider Weight Distribution

The weight distribution of your fish tank is another critical factor in maintaining your stand’s stability. Ensure that the weight of the aquarium is evenly distributed on the stand’s surface. Use a leveling tool to check the balance of the stand and adjust it accordingly. Overloading one side of the stand can cause it to tilt and potentially damage the aquarium.

Tip #5: Regular Maintenance

Regular maintenance of your fish tank stand is crucial in extending its lifespan. Lubricate any moving parts of the stand, such as hinges or wheels, to keep them functioning smoothly. Replace any worn-out or damaged parts to prevent further damage. It is always better to fix minor issues promptly before they escalate into significant problems.
